Understanding Brake Pads and Rotors: The Basics
Brake pads and rotors are critical elements of your vehicle's disc brake system. When you apply the brakes, hydraulic pressure forces the brake pads against the rotors, creating friction that slows or stops the wheels. Brake pads are composed of a friction material bonded to a metal backing plate, while rotors are metal discs attached to the wheel hubs. Over time, both components wear down and require replacement to maintain braking efficiency. Worn brake pads can lead to longer stopping distances, noise, and rotor damage. Similarly, warped or thin rotors can cause vibrations and reduce safety. Types of NAPA Brake Pads: Materials and Applications
NAPA offers a range of brake pads tailored to different driving needs and vehicle types. The primary categories are organic, semi-metallic, and ceramic brake pads. Organic brake pads, also known as non-asbestos organic (NAO), are made from materials like glass, rubber, and Kevlar. They provide quiet operation and are less abrasive on rotors, making them suitable for everyday commuting. However, they may wear faster under heavy use. Semi-metallic brake pads contain metal fibers such as steel or copper, offering improved heat dissipation and performance in high-stress situations like towing or mountain driving. They are durable but can be noisier and may produce more brake dust. Ceramic brake pads, a premium option, use ceramic compounds and copper fibers. They excel in providing consistent braking, low noise, minimal dust, and long life, though they are often more expensive. Types of NAPA Brake Rotors: Design and Function
Brake rotors, also called brake discs, come in various designs to manage heat and wear. NAPA supplies solid rotors, which are single pieces of metal, commonly used in standard passenger vehicles for basic driving conditions. Ventilated rotors feature internal vanes that allow air to flow through, cooling the rotor more effectively during frequent braking; these are ideal for front axles on many cars and SUVs. Slotted rotors have grooves cut into the surface to expel gas and debris, improving wet-weather performance and reducing fade. Drilled rotors have holes drilled through them for enhanced cooling and are often found in performance vehicles, though they may be prone to cracking under extreme stress. NAPA also offers coated rotors with anti-corrosion finishes to prevent rust and extend lifespan. Selecting the right rotor depends on factors like vehicle weight, driving style, and environmental conditions. NAPA's product descriptions provide guidance on these aspects.

Installation Process for NAPA Brake Pads and Rotors
Installing NAPA brake pads and rotors is a manageable task for those with mechanical experience, but if unsure, consult a professional. Safety first: park on a level surface, engage the parking brake, and use wheel chocks. Gather tools like a jack, jack stands, lug wrench, C-clamp, socket set, and torque wrench. Begin by loosening the lug nuts, lifting the vehicle, and removing the wheel. Locate the brake caliper, which holds the pads, and remove its bolts to slide it off the rotor. Support the caliper with a hanger to avoid straining the brake hose. Remove the old pads and inspect the caliper for damage. For rotor replacement, take off the caliper bracket if necessary, and slide the rotor off the hub; it may require tapping if rusted. Clean the hub surface with a wire brush. Install the new NAPA rotor, ensuring it sits flush. Place the new NAPA pads into the caliper bracket, applying brake grease to contact points if recommended. Reattach the caliper, compressing the piston with a C-clamp for clearance. Reinstall the wheel, torque the lug nuts to specification, and lower the vehicle. Repeat for all wheels needing service. After installation, pump the brake pedal to restore pressure and test drive at low speeds to bed in the pads, following NAPA's guidelines for proper break-in.
Maintenance Tips for Long-Lasting Brake Performance
Regular maintenance extends the life of your NAPA brake pads and rotors. Inspect brakes every 12,000 miles or as advised in your vehicle manual. Look for pad thickness; if pads are below 1/4 inch, consider replacement. Check rotors for scoring, grooves, or warping, which can cause vibrations. Listen for squealing or grinding noises, which indicate wear. Monitor brake fluid levels and change fluid every two years to prevent moisture buildup that can affect braking. Clean wheels periodically to remove brake dust, which can accumulate and cause corrosion. Avoid harsh braking when possible, as it generates excessive heat and wear. If you notice pulling to one side, soft pedals, or pulsations, have the system checked immediately. NAPA products are durable, but proper care ensures they perform as intended.
